The verse
汝是懸崖一樹梅一塵不染向春開待看綠葉成蔭後結子滿枝調鼎來
In English
You are a plum tree on a cliff.Unstained by dust, you open toward spring.Wait until green leaves become shade.Then fruit will fill the branches, fit to season the great cauldron.
Textual notes
綠葉 is sometimes written as 緣葉, likely in error. 調鼎 means cooking or, by extension, governing as a prime minister would.
The twelve aspects
A temple slip does not give one answer. The same four lines are read differently depending on what you came to ask about, and these are the twelve readings traditionally set down for this sign.
- Career and Recognition
- You may take first place among the flowers; your name can appear on the honors list.
- Business
- Full wealth energy; you return fully laden.
- Pregnancy and Children
- The highest completeness; many fine children.
- Health
- Spring light becomes harmonious, and the body gradually recovers.
- Marriage
- Two good people unite; spring light is bright.
- Travel
- Spring wind is everywhere; no direction is unfavorable.
- Household
- One good heart plants for children and grandchildren.
- Wealth
- Do not take what is unjust; proper wealth is easy to obtain.
- Current Fortune
- The great path brings wealth; when fortune arrives, it turns to gold.
- Lost Item
- Hard to find at once; pray, and it can be found.
- Farming
- Production is acceptable; still pray for divine help.
- Legal Matters
- A benefactor supports you; litigation brings no blame.
